Alen Shtogrin

Pyraminx · top 19.1% of 129,321 all-time · competing since January 2019 · 2019SHTO01

Alen Shtogrin has been competing for 8 years. His best event is the Pyraminx: a personal-best single of 5.88, set at Cubing Semey Open 2019, puts him in the top 19.1% of the 129,321 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 141st in Kazakhstan. Across 5 competitions since January 2019, he has put 164 official solves on the record across nine events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 12% around a typical one, an early reading from 7 counted rounds. That figure sets aside his 3 DNFs. His 3×3 best has come down from 29.33 in January 2019 to 17.68, a 40% improvement. Alen has entered five competitions, more competitions than 83%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
